Transaction 96b496a990a58561c6aa32236f2981d106bc3aa3e109d416e52a4d1a17e06abb
1 Input
1 Output
-
96b496a990a58561c6aa32236f2981d106bc3aa3e109d416e52a4d1a17e06abb:0
- value
- 63445
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b33737b56fad6882e1a7f3878c23a90c06e77756 OP_EQUAL
- address
- 3J2d2U7oskcwqLa6bPpkCG28zPqWYX2vhA